## Summary by CodeRabbit

* **New Features**
* Added a new import pipeline with “plan then commit” batch handling for
Markdown, Notion HTML, Obsidian, and Bear backups.
* Enabled native import sessions with progress, cancellation, and
batch-by-batch committing (including assets, folders, icons, and tags).
  * Added web preflight limits for ZIP and multi-file imports.
* **Bug Fixes**
* Improved import error/warning reporting and continued processing when
some items fail.
* Strengthened snapshot-based file/directory picking to preserve paths.
* **Chores**
  * Updated project packaging/configuration for the new import workflow.
